Entry-Level Environmental Scientist

AECOM is a trusted infrastructure consulting firm delivering a better world through innovative solutions. The Entry-Level Environmental Scientist will support the EHS & Air team, assisting with environmental data analysis, compliance plans, and site assessments under the guidance of senior team members.

Responsibilities

Work within our Environment business line as part of our EHS team
Assist with gathering and analyzing environmental data in both the field and office settings
Assist in the preparation of investigation reports, assessments, permitting, and drawings
Interpret and record data, conduct analyses, compare findings to relevant studies and local, state and federal regulations to ensure compliance

Required

Bachelor's Degree in Environmental Science, Geology, Chemistry, or demonstrated equivalency of experience and/or education
Valid U.S. Driver's License required to visit project sites, clients, and other AECOM offices
As a condition of employment, selected candidate must pass a Motor Vehicle Records review and a substance abuse test
Due to the nature of work, US citizenship is required

Preferred

Strong technical background
Good interpersonal and communication skills, comfortable meeting with clients, colleagues, and sub-contractors alike. Excellent written and verbal skills
Willingness and ability to learn and rapidly master new tasks
Strong research and report writing (including web-based research). Proficient with Microsoft Office (Word, PowerPoint, Excel)
Strong quality and time management. Solid attention to detail and thorough approach to work
40-hour HAZWOPER training and 8-hour refresher training, as applicable
